gpt4 book ai didi

ios - Phonegap PushPlugin 无法接收通知 ios

转载 作者:塔克拉玛干 更新时间:2023-11-02 08:19:22 27 4
gpt4 key购买 nike

我正在为 Android 和 iOS 开发一个 Phonegap 应用程序,并希望为两者启用推送通知。

该应用正在使用 Phonegap 插件 PushPlugin,该插件将其设置为接收 Android 和 iOS 的通知。

我在使用该应用程序的 iOS 版本时遇到问题。运行它时,屏幕询问我是否要允许该应用程序接收通知,我选择是,然后我收到一个设备 token ,然后在服务器端使用该 token 将通知发送到选定的设备。这很好地表明 Phonegap 插件正在运行

服务器端,我正在使用 AmazonSNS 发送通知。 (此Java代码可下载here.)

对于 AmazonSNS,我需要传入:

  • 证书(在在线 iOS 开发中心创建)
  • 私钥(从证书中导出)
  • 设备 token (来自 PushPlugin)

发送通知。

我关注了this有关如何设置应用程序 ID、证书、私钥和配置文件的详细教程。

问题是,在发送通知后,应用程序不仅没有收到通知,而且发送通知也没有出错,也没有给我任何关于可能出错的反馈。

我还要指出,应用程序的 Android 版本使用相同的 java 代码成功接收通知。

任何关于这里可能是什么问题的建议都会很好。

谢谢

最佳答案

我设法找出问题所在。

在我的服务器端插件中,我试图直接连接到 APNS,但我应该做的是连接到 APNS_SANDBOX

关于ios - Phonegap PushPlugin 无法接收通知 ios,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21167164/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com